Laparoscopic Entry: Traditional Methods, New Insights And Novel Approaches discusses traditional methods of laparoscopic surgery, new devices, laparoscopic entry in difficult patients, robotic assisted surgery access, single port entry, gasless access, transvaginal entry and natural orifice surgery. This book illustrates, through the presentation of techniques, methods, photos, images, drawings and pictures, all the possible methods of laparoscopic entry for endoscopic surgeons, either for laparoscopy or for robotics. Laparoscopic Entry: Traditional Methods, New Insights And Novel Approaches describes problems and criticisms of each method and highlights common and rare complications.Written by experts in the field, this book also includes tips and tricks, which can be tailored to each patient, making it a valuable reference tool for gynecologists, urologists, vascular and general surgeons.

The repair and management of inguinal hernias represents a significant part of the general surgeon's workload. It was therefore inevitable that following the success of laparoscopic cholysysectomy, surgeons would develop a procedure for repairing inguinal hernias laparoscopically. This book provides the first comprehensive account of laparoscopic inguinal hernia repair. The Editors' aim has been to give step-by-step guidance to each operative procedure discussed with reference to long term results. One of the biggest problems facing surgeons learning new laparoscopic procedures is an understanding and orientation of basic anatomy when viewed through the laparoscope. This issue is discussed at length with guidance on how to avoid the common pitfalls. Final chapters look at the advantages and disadvantages of the Lichtenstein open mesh hernia repair approach, safety and properties of non-absorbal mesh with the last chapters concentrating on laparoscopic suture repair and the new mini hernia operation.

Primary and incisional ventral hernias are common conditions often encountered in surgical practice. Because of the frequency of this problem it has come to be managed by surgeons in general, regardless of the type of hospital or the conditions dealt with in their daily practice. Laparoscopic surgery has demonstrated to have an important role among the different technique described to repair ventral hernia with less recurrent rate, less morbidity and less overall cost than open conventional repair, with all the advange of the laparoscopic approach. As a result the indications for this surgical technique are currently being debated since the advantages are evident and progressive implementation is ensured. Now is the time to analyze the usefulness, results, technical variants, anatomic, physiologic and scientific basis and implications involved in implementation of laparoscopy as the technique of choice.
